Pilot Road 4 GT: Stiffer casing with a patented new technology for motorcycle tires that delivers the stability you need for heavier GT-class bikes while riding solo, two-up or with luggage, and the comfort you desire. 20% softer rubber mix on the edges of the tread yields phenomenal cornering grip. In the Six-Day War in 1967, Israel captured Jerusalem's Old City and the Temple Mount/Haram al-Sharif (Noble Sanctuary) from Jordan, alongside the rest of East Jerusalem, the West Bank, and the Gaza Strip.
